Tell me about this Briggs copy?

We think that you'll fall in love with this Briggs copy instrument because it really is a great model to play. The flat back with upper angle break, the nicely raked upper shoulders and the string length of 104.7cm mean that it is a very, very easy instrument to get around. In terms of the sound department – thanks to the generously proportioned lower bouts and rib-depth - both volume of sound and tonal quality are mighty impressive.

Stats:

LOB (length of back) - 114.4cm (45.00in)
Width at the upper bouts - 53.3cm (21.00in)
Width at the middle bouts - 36.7cm (14.30in)
Width at the lower bouts - 68.6cm (27.00in)
Depth of lower ribs inc both plates- 23.1cm (9.10in) Body stop - 60.0cm (23.65in)
St. length - 104.7cm (41.20in)
